Abstract
PURPOSE: In the titled distillation column wherein flow rate of reflux can not be measured because the distillation is equipped with a condenser at its top, to obtain high-quality ethane, by estimating and calculating a reflux ratio of flow rate of reflux/flow rate of distillation through indirect measurement to give information, controlling the reflux ratio based on the information.
CONSTITUTION: In a distillation column for distilling LNG equipped with a condenser at its upper part, (i) the amount of condensation of LNG (L+D) is obtained from the amount of vaporization of a refrigerant in the condenser (F1-F2), (ii) the flow rate of reflux (L) or the reflux ratio (L/D) is obtained from the amount of condensation of (L+D) and the flow the rate of product (D), and (iii) the reflux ratio is controlled constant by operating the heat source (Q) for vaporizing the LNG using the information of the flow rate of reflux (L) or the reflux ratio (L/D). Control of reflux ratio is made possible even if heat transfer efficiency changes (freezing) in the piping of LNG in a warm water tank by this method in the above-mentioned distillation column wherein the reflux ratio can not be measured directly, and high-quality ethane can be recovered from LNG.
